How is Your BNI Visa Affinity Platinum Limit Determined?
Okay, now let's get down to the juicy stuff: how does BNI actually decide your BNI Visa Affinity Platinum limit? It's not just a random number they pull out of a hat, guys! Several factors are taken into consideration. First and foremost, your creditworthiness is a major player. This is based on your credit score, which is a three-digit number summarizing your credit history. The higher your score, the better your chances of getting a higher credit limit. Credit scores are determined by your payment history, the amount of debt you owe, the length of your credit history, the types of credit you use, and any new credit you've recently applied for. So, making timely payments, keeping your credit utilization low, and generally managing your credit responsibly are all super important. The bank also assesses your income and employment status. They want to ensure you have the financial capacity to repay the credit you're borrowing. This means providing proof of income, such as pay stubs or tax returns, and demonstrating a stable employment history. Your debt-to-income ratio (DTI) also plays a big role. This is the percentage of your gross monthly income that goes towards paying debts. A lower DTI indicates you have more available income to handle your credit card payments, which could lead to a higher credit limit. Managing Your BNI Visa Affinity Platinum Limit
Okay, you've got your BNI Visa Affinity Platinum limit set, now what? The most crucial thing is responsible management, my friends! Here’s how you can make sure you're using your credit wisely. First off, keep track of your spending. With your credit card in your wallet, it’s easy to lose track. Use online banking, mobile apps, or even a simple spreadsheet to monitor your transactions regularly. This will help you stay within your limit and avoid any nasty surprises. Next, aim to keep your credit utilization low. Credit utilization refers to the percentage of your credit limit that you're using. A good rule of thumb is to keep your credit utilization below 30%. For example, if your credit limit is IDR 10,000,000, try to keep your balance below IDR 3,000,000. Low credit utilization often indicates that you're a responsible borrower. Set a budget and stick to it. Before you start swiping your card, create a budget and allocate funds for your expenses. This will help you plan your spending and avoid overspending. Make sure you know when your statement period ends and when your payment due date is. And of course, pay your bills on time, every time! Late payments can lead to late fees, interest charges, and a negative impact on your credit score. If possible, set up automatic payments to avoid missing a due date. Consider requesting a credit limit increase. If you consistently manage your credit responsibly and have a good payment history, you can request a credit limit increase from BNI. Potential Downsides and Risks
While a higher credit limit offers many advantages, there are some potential downsides and risks associated with it, guys. It's important to be aware of these so you can use your credit card responsibly. One of the primary risks is the temptation to overspend. Having a higher credit limit can sometimes lead to the urge to make unnecessary purchases or spend more than you can afford. It's easy to lose track and accumulate a large balance if you're not careful. Increased debt is another significant risk. If you overspend and fail to manage your card balance, you can accumulate a substantial amount of debt. This can lead to financial stress and difficulty in repaying your debts. Higher interest charges are also something to be aware of. If you carry a balance on your credit card and don't pay it off in full each month, you'll be charged interest. The higher your balance, the more interest you'll pay. The BNI Visa Affinity Platinum limit is a great thing, but you have to be mindful. Credit card misuse can damage your credit score. If you consistently miss payments or max out your credit limit, it can negatively impact your credit score. This can make it harder to get approved for loans or credit in the future and could increase the interest rates you're charged. Therefore, managing your credit responsibly is super important.
